Stripe Configure

Set up Stripe Dashboard and deployment environment variables.

Objective

Configure everything outside the codebase: Stripe Dashboard settings, environment variables across all deployments, webhook endpoints.

Process

  1. Stripe Dashboard Setup

Guide the user through (or use Stripe CLI where possible):

Products & Prices

  • Create product (name matches app)

  • Create price(s): monthly, annual if applicable

  • Note the price IDs for env vars

Webhook Endpoint

  • Create endpoint pointing to production URL

  • Use canonical domain (www if that's where app lives — Stripe doesn't follow redirects)

  • Enable required events (from design)

  • Copy webhook signing secret

Customer Portal (if using)

  • Configure allowed actions

  • Set branding

  1. Environment Variables

Set variables on ALL deployment targets. This is where incidents happen.

Local Development

.env.local

STRIPE_SECRET_KEY=sk_test_... STRIPE_WEBHOOK_SECRET=whsec_... NEXT_PUBLIC_STRIPE_PUBLISHABLE_KEY=pk_test_... NEXT_PUBLIC_STRIPE_PRICE_ID=price_...

Convex (both dev and prod)

Dev

npx convex env set STRIPE_SECRET_KEY "sk_test_..." npx convex env set STRIPE_WEBHOOK_SECRET "whsec_..."

Prod (DON'T FORGET THIS)

npx convex env set --prod STRIPE_SECRET_KEY "sk_live_..." npx convex env set --prod STRIPE_WEBHOOK_SECRET "whsec_..."

Vercel

vercel env add STRIPE_SECRET_KEY production vercel env add STRIPE_WEBHOOK_SECRET production

... etc

  1. Verify Parity

Check that all deployments have matching configuration:

  • Local has test keys

  • Convex dev has test keys

  • Convex prod has live keys

  • Vercel prod has live keys

Use verify-env-parity.sh if available, or manually compare.

  1. Webhook URL Verification

CRITICAL: Verify webhook URL doesn't redirect.

curl -s -o /dev/null -w "%{http_code}" -I -X POST "https://your-domain.com/api/stripe/webhook"

Must return 4xx or 5xx, NOT 3xx. If it redirects, fix the URL in Stripe Dashboard.

Common Mistakes

  • Setting env vars on dev but forgetting prod

  • Using wrong domain (non-www when app is www)

  • Trailing whitespace in secrets (use printf '%s' not echo )

  • Test keys in production, live keys in development
